Historic 1923 Little House: Charming, Efficient & Perfectly Located in Pasadena
The Little House is a historic 1923 house that has been completely rebuilt to take full advantage of its unique size. It is an excellent example of efficiency. Stylishly furnished with modern and traditional furniture and art, it is the perfect alternative to a hotel. The neighborhood is quiet and pleasant for walking, and it is a five-minute drive to all that Pasadena has to offer – world-class museums, outstanding colleges and universities, top-rated restaurants and shopping, historic Old Town, hiking and other outdoor activities, and the Rose Bowl.
The house has a newly rebuilt kitchen with a two burner gas stove, small refrigerator, combination microwave/convection oven for roasting and baking, coffee maker, toaster, and a water filter for drinking water. We also offer WiFi, washer/dryer, newly installed and regularly serviced mini-split AC/heater, peaceful covered deck, and the privacy of staying in your own house.
The Little House is less than 15 miles from Downtown Los Angeles, Hollywood, and Burbank, which can all be accessed by easy connections with the Metro Gold Line or by freeway, one of which is the newly restored historic Arroyo Parkway, the nation’s first freeway.
Owners Todd and Liz purchased this house in 2006. Todd spent his childhood a few blocks away and was fascinated by this tiny house.
